The first, and arguably most decisiv, moment in that value chain is the instant a chick leaves the hatcher. If males and females are not accurately separated at day‑old, every downstream activity, from feed formulation to thinning schedules and processing weights, is forced to compensate for variability.

The system classifies gender with proven accuracy levels that routinely exceed 97% across entire production shifts.
That consistency delivers tangible operational gains:
• More predictable feed conversion ratios (FCR): With males and females reared separately, FCR becomes more consistent, enabling tighter diet optimization and reducing costly over‑ or under‑formulation.
• Higher processing yield compliance: When flocks converge toward target weights within narrow tolerance bands, plants can meet fixed‑weight order programs with fewer regrades and less giveaway.
Modular, Compact Design: Fit Today, Scale Tomorrow
Genesys addresses space constraints with a ready‑to‑use 5 m² module.
Scalability is equally straightforward.

Each Genesys module processes up to 50,000 chicks per hour. If production volume rises, simply add another module in parallel; the software automatically pools throughput data for unified reporting. Whether you have one lane or ten, dashboard views remain consolidated.
Serviceability follows the same logic: the modular design means critical components (camera arrays, pneumatic actuators, lighting bars) can be swapped in minutes without specialized tools.
Downtime is measured in minutes rather than hours, supporting the relentless cadence of large‑scale hatcheries.
